Strong's Concordance G565

Original Word: ἀπέρχομαι
Transliteration: apérchomai
Phonetic Spelling: ap-erkh'-om-ahee
[ἀπέρχομαι] from G575 and G2064; to go off (i.e. depart), aside (i.e. apart) or behind (i.e. follow), literally or figuratively
